What did model Ngoc Trinh say about the incident where she let two people off the motorbike?

VietNamNetVietNamNet19/10/2023


As previously reported, the Ho Chi Minh City Police Investigation Agency has initiated legal proceedings and temporarily detained Tran Thi Ngoc Trinh (also known as model Ngoc Trinh, 34 years old) on charges of "Disrupting public order" as stipulated in Article 318 of the Penal Code.

Simultaneously, the police initiated criminal proceedings and issued a travel ban against Tran Xuan Dong (36 years old, residing in District 4) for the crimes of "Using forged documents of an agency or organization" and "Disrupting public order" as stipulated in Articles 314 and 318 of the Penal Code. To date, the Ho Chi Minh City Police have clarified the relevant details.

The incident involving model Ngoc Trinh and her videos of her riding a motorbike dangerously while letting go of the handlebars, which have been widely shared in recent days, has caused public outrage.

During the investigation and questioning by task forces from the Thu Duc City Police, the Road and Rail Traffic Police Department, and the Office of the Criminal Investigation Agency (Ho Chi Minh City Police), Ngoc Trinh admitted to all the violations as reflected in the videos on social media.

Ngoc Trinh revealed that she has a passion for large-displacement motorcycles, so she hired Tran Xuan Dong as a driving instructor in order to pass her A2 driving test in the near future. They chose quiet roads to practice on, and when feeling enthusiastic, Ngoc Trinh would ride alone or, together with Dong, they would navigate busy roads.

Ngoc Trinh stated, "I never imagined I would be violating the law so seriously."

The police clarified, and Ngọc Trinh herself stated, that during her training sessions with her instructor, her manager and housekeeper accompanied her to provide support and film the training.

Afterward, Ngoc Trinh's team edited the footage, and Ngoc Trinh herself uploaded the clips to her personal social media accounts: TikTok "Ngoc Trinh" (with 6.8 million followers) posted 5 videos related to her driving a large-displacement motorcycle with provocative and dangerous maneuvers on September 24-28 and October 2-6-8; Facebook "Tran Thi Ngoc Trinh (The girl who eats out - with over 3.1 million followers)" and the Fanpage "NGOC TRINH" (currently with 2.7 million likes; 5.9 million followers) posted 1 video showing Ngoc Trinh driving a large-displacement motorcycle and having an accident resulting in a leg injury.

Ngoc Trinh and Dong stated that the videos on social media, as mentioned above, were not intended for advertising purposes for large-displacement motorcycle brands. Ngoc Trinh's intention, being a celebrity, was to create an image and promote herself on social media.

Investigators believe that Ngoc Trinh is a social influencer with millions of followers on her personal social media accounts, and therefore, posting and distributing the aforementioned video clips negatively impacts public order and safety, and adversely affects the awareness, lifestyle, and cultural behavior of young people.

The Ho Chi Minh City Police Investigation Agency continues to conduct investigations and verifications in accordance with regulations to promptly clarify the entire case, the criminal acts of Tran Thi Ngoc Trinh, Tran Xuan Dong, and other related individuals, in order to thoroughly and strictly handle them according to the law.
